Discontinued DP4967 Iron Cobalt Nickel Chromium Silicon High Entropy Alloy Powder (FeCoNiCrSi HEA Powder)

Catalogue Number DP4967
Composition Fe, Co, Ni, Cr, Si
Purity 99%
Appearance Gray or black powder
Particle Size 0-25um, 15-53um, 53-150um, or Custom Made

FeCoNiCrSi High Entropy Alloy Powder is a fine and homogeneous powder material, composed of an equimolar or nearly equimolar combination of Iron (Fe), Cobalt (Co), Nickel (Ni), Chromium (Cr), and Silicon (Si).
